Explained: How deep-sea mining noise pollution threatens whales
• 2 years agoUnderwater noise generated by industrial or military operations can induce foraging whales to surface more quickly than normal, increasing the risk of gas bubbles forming in the bloodstream, which can in turn lead to stranding and death
